Mesothelioma Lawyers

Mesothelioma attorneys specialize in asbestos litigation, including lawsuits and claims against trust funds. To be able to successfully handle these claims, they must be familiar with complex state laws and the national legal requirements.

They should also be able to access asbestos databases of contaminated work sites and be able to identify asbestos manufacturers who may be responsible for exposure. The right asbestos lawyer makes the process of filing a lawsuit simple so that victims can concentrate on treatment and being with their loved family members.

Experience

A lawyer who has years of experience handling asbestos cases is an essential benefit to your case. The best asbestos lawyers have a track record of obtaining compensation for their clients and their families. Utilize online resources like FindLaw to locate attorneys and law offices that specialize in asbestos litigation. Once you've made a list, interview the attorneys and law firms to ensure that they meet your needs.

The first step to filing an asbestos lawsuit is meeting with a mesothelioma attorney to get a free case evaluation. Your lawyer will help you determine which corporations are accountable for your case, and which kind of claim is the best. Asbestos exposure can occur in a variety of forms and it could be difficult for victims to remember exactly the time they were exposed, or at what locations. However, mesothelioma lawyers have access to databases that list thousands of companies, products, and work locations where asbestos exposure occurred.

Asbestos lawyers are also able to look into the specifics of a case to find evidence that supports your claims. For instance, you may have medical records to prove your mesothelioma diagnosis or an official death certificate that lists "mesothelioma" as the cause of the loved one's death. Asbestos lawyers know how to request these documents and what you should ask to get the most value out of them.

A mesothelioma attorney who is knowledgeable will also know how state laws impact the how you submit your lawsuit. In New York, for example you have to file your lawsuit within the state if the business that exposed you to asbestos is located in that. Attorneys from nationwide firms have experience in filing claims across multiple states and know the law in each state.

Mesothelioma is a painful, life-threatening disease that affects the lining of the lungs and chest cavity. It is caused by exposure to asbestos, which was used in a range of commercial and residential construction materials for more than 30 years. Exposure can have taken place in a variety of locations, including at school, at work, or at home.

When an individual is diagnosed with mesothelioma they can bring a personal injury lawsuit against the company that is responsible for their exposure to asbestos. They can also file a claim for the wrongful death of loved ones who have died from mesothelioma or other asbestos-related diseases.

Asbestos sufferers can claim financial compensation for expenses like lost wages, medical bills and the costs of treatment. Asbestos lawyers can help clients get these damages back through filing a mesothelioma lawsuit or a trust fund claim against the companies that are responsible for their exposure to asbestos. They can also aid their clients in filing a wrongful death lawsuit on behalf a loved one that has died from mesothelioma.
